The idea of banning No-Bid government contracts shows a total ignorance of contracting realities, particularly in the defense arena. In the case of defense hardware, often there is only one qualified supplier available, so you buy from him or you don’t get it! There is a process by which second-sources can be qualified, but it is lengthy and very costly. No-bid contracts are hardly windfalls for companies – they are usually cost-plus fixed percentage fee; the government has audit approval of all costs, including overhead.
